Analysis

In 2023, outbound internationally mobile tertiary students studying in south in Iraq stood at 1,662.

That represents a change of up 177.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, outbound internationally mobile tertiary students studying in south in Iraq peaked at 1,709 in 2020 and was at its lowest, 384, in 2012.

Iraq ranks 4th of 210 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 12 years of available data.

Outbound internationally mobile tertiary students studying in South in Iraq, year by year

Annual values for Outbound internationally mobile tertiary students studying in South and West Asia, female (UIS estimate) (number) in Iraq, 2012 to 2023.
Year Value Change
2012 384
2013 600 +56.2%
2014 766 +27.7%
2015 695 -9.3%
2016 991 +42.6%
2017 1,143 +15.3%
2018 1,201 +5.1%
2019 1,347 +12.2%
2020 1,709 +26.9%
2021 1,654 -3.2%
2022 1,662 +0.5%
2023 1,662 +0.0%
